When individuals share their stories and are met with silence and attention rather than immediate judgment or advice, a profound sense of validation occurs. This process breaks down the isolation that many professionals feel. It transforms a group of strangers or colleagues into a community. In the context of "Hayat," this is essential; just as life thrives on connection, professional and personal growth thrive on the nutrient of community support. The circle allows participants to witness their own struggles in the narratives of others, normalizing their experiences and reducing anxiety.
